"It is rather strange Ogden did not speak of him." She went down stairs again and back to the dining-room.

Eeny was there, standing before the fire, her light shape and delicate face looking fragile in the red fire-light.
"Oh, Grace," said she, "I have just sent Babette in search of you.

There is a visitor in the parlour for you." "For me ?" "Yes, a gentleman; young, and rather handsome.

I asked him who I should say wished to see you, and--what do you think ?--he would not tell." "No! What did he say ?" "Told me to mention to Miss Grace Danton that a friend wished to see her.

Mysterious, is it not ?" "Who can it be ?" said Grace, thoughtfully.
